A body composition model to estimate mammalian energy stores and metabolic rates from body mass and body length, with application to polar bears
Download2009-01-01
Derocher, Andrew E., Klanjscek, Tin, Molnár, Péter K., Lewis, Mark A., Obbard, Martyn E.
Many species experience large fluctuations in food availability and depend on energy from fat and protein stores for survival, reproduction and growth. Body condition and, more specifically, energy stores thus constitute key variables in the life history of many species. Several indices exist to...

A common fungal associate of the spruce bark beetle metabolizes the stilbene defenses of Norway spruce
Download2013-01-01
Paetz, Christian, Wadke, Namita, Brand, Willi A., Wright, Louwrance P., Gershenzon, Jonathan, Schmidt, Axel, Fenning, Trevor M., Schneider, BerndBohlmann, Joerg, Hammerbacher, Almuth
Norway spruce (Picea abies) forests suffer periodic fatal attacks by the bark beetle Ips typographus and its fungal associate, Ceratocystis polonica. Norway spruce protects itself against fungal and bark beetle invasion by the production of terpenoid resins, but it is unclear whether resins or...

A framework for analyzing the robustness of movement models to variable step discretization
Download2016-01-01
Schlägel, Ulrike E, Lewis, Mark A.
When sampling animal movement paths, the frequency at which location measurements are attempted is a critical feature for data analysis. Important quantities derived from raw data, e.g. travel distance or sinuosity, can differ largely based on the temporal resolution of the data. Likewise, when...

A general theory for target reproduction numbers with applications to ecology and epidemiology
Download2019-01-01
Mark A. Lewis, Zhisheng Shuai, P. van den Driessche
A general framework for threshold parameters in population dynamics is developed using the concept of target reproduction numbers. This framework identies reproduction numbers and other threshold parameters in the literature in terms of their roles in population control. The framework is applied...

A generalized residual technique for analysing complex movement models using earth mover's distance.
Download2014-10-01
Potts, Jonathan R, Marie Auger-M´eth´e, Karl Mokross, Mark A. Lewis
Complex systems of moving and interacting objects are ubiquitous in the natural and social sciences. Predicting their behaviour often requires models that mimic these systems with sufficient accuracy, while accounting for their inherent stochasticity. Although tools exist to determine which of a...
